Transitioning to Motherhood: Balancing Career and Life

Becoming a stay-at-home mom is no easy feat. It can be an overwhelming transition, especially if you have been working full-time before. However, many still choose to make the switch and find it incredibly rewarding. In fact, one out of five parents in the United States is a stay-at-home mom today.

But that doesn’t mean you should stop striving for personal growth. With the right strategies and resources, you can master balancing your career and life and make motherhood an enjoyable experience. Here are some tips on how to shift your lifestyle as a stay-at-home mom.

Make Time for Yourself

Though it may be hard to find the time, taking care of yourself should be your top priority. Especially for first-time moms, it can be tempting to let your responsibilities overtake any personal development you may have planned. But setting aside just a few minutes a day to do something that relaxes or inspires you can make a huge difference.

Make sure to carve out time for yourself and your hobbies, like reading a book or going for a walk. You can also do something as simple as meditating or stretching for a few minutes each day. Doing so will help you stay focused and energized, even when being a stay-at-home mom is hectic.

Taking good care of yourself will give you more energy to take care of your children and pursue a career from home. Remember that self-care should always come first, so make sure to give yourself some time each day. As a result, you’ll be able to take better care of yourself and your family.

Set Up a Home Office

Creating a home office is crucial when transitioning to a stay-at-home mom lifestyle. Think of it as a space solely dedicated to your professional and creative endeavors. You can use it to get your ideas out, further develop your skills, and even make money from home.

Having an office will also help you separate work from leisure. It doesn’t have to be fancy — just a small desk and chair in an empty corner of your home will do the trick. Be Comfortable With Change

Every new chapter in life requires adjusting to new changes, including being a stay-at-home mom transitioning into motherhood. So, being ready and comfortable with adapting is extremely important.

As much as possible, don’t resist change but rather embrace it with open arms. Be flexible when making decisions to prevent burnout and stress while juggling work and family obligations. Also, don’t forget to ask for help when needed — accepting help from those around you can make all the difference.

Soon enough, you’ll be able to adjust to the new changes with ease and become a pro at balancing your career and life.

Create Structure & Routines

Creating structure helps keep yourself organized so you can manage work and family responsibilities efficiently. Establishing routines can help streamline everyday tasks like meal planning, cleaning, or running errands — things that need to get done but require minimal thinking on your part.

These routines allow you more free time for yourself or other activities that need more thought or creativity, such as pursuing projects or hobbies related to work or leisurely pastimes. Keeping track of your goals will also help you stay focused and motivated. Whether it’s pursuing a specific career goal or taking on a home improvement project, having a plan of action will help you stay on track.

By creating routines and setting goals, you can better manage your time and responsibilities. This will enable you to make the most of your day, create a sense of accomplishment, and ultimately enjoy being a stay-at-home mom.
